Introduction: Why Cultural Competency and Communication Matter in Aviation
In modern aviation, no flight operates in isolation. Every takeoff, maneuver, and landing involves coordination among pilots, air traffic controllers, cabin crew, ground staff, and maintenance teams who often come from vastly different cultural backgrounds. Misunderstandings born from cultural differences or unclear communication remain a contributing factor in incidents ranging from minor procedural deviations to serious safety events. Flight simulator scenarios offer a controlled, repeatable environment where pilots and crew can build the cultural competency and communication skills essential for safe operations. By embedding these competencies into simulation-based training, organizations prepare aviation professionals to handle real-world diversity confidently, reduce error, and strengthen team cohesion across every role in the cockpit and beyond.
Understanding Cultural Competency in Aviation
Cultural competency refers to the ability to recognize, respect, and adapt to cultural differences in values, communication styles, decision-making norms, and authority structures. In aviation, where precision and clarity are non-negotiable, cultural misunderstandings can introduce ambiguity at critical moments. For instance, a pilot from a culture that discourages questioning authority may hesitate to challenge a captain's decision even when safety margins shrink. Similarly, crew members may interpret silence, eye contact, or indirect language differently, leading to missed cues during high-workload phases of flight. Cultural competency does not require memorizing every cultural trait; instead, it demands awareness, curiosity, and the skill to adjust one's communication and behavior to maintain shared understanding in a multicultural team.

Key Dimensions of Cultural Competency for Aviation Professionals
To design effective simulation scenarios, trainers must understand which cultural dimensions most influence cockpit and crew interactions. Research in cross-cultural psychology, particularly the work of Geert Hofstede and subsequent aviation-focused studies, points to several dimensions that directly affect communication and decision-making in flight operations.
Communication Styles: High-Context vs. Low-Context
In low-context cultures (common in North America, Germany, and Scandinavia), communication tends to be explicit, direct, and verbal. Messages are conveyed clearly through words, and ambiguity is minimized. In high-context cultures (common in parts of Asia, the Middle East, and Latin America), much of the meaning is embedded in nonverbal cues, shared experience, and the relational context. A high-context communicator may use indirect language to express concern or disagreement, expecting the listener to read between the lines. In a flight simulator scenario, training participants to recognize these differences and explicitly verify understanding—rather than assuming—can prevent subtle but dangerous miscommunications during approach, taxi, or abnormal procedures.
Power Distance and Authority Gradients
Power distance refers to the degree to which less powerful members of a group accept and expect unequal distribution of authority. In high power distance cultures, junior crew members may be reluctant to question senior pilots or captains, even when they observe an error. This dynamic directly undermines the principles of Crew Resource Management (CRM), which encourages open communication regardless of rank. Simulation scenarios that include high power distance dynamics—such as a first officer from a high power distance culture interacting with a captain from a low power distance culture—help trainees practice assertive yet respectful communication. Trainers can build scenarios where the junior crewmember must speak up about a potential mistake, and the debriefing can explore how cultural expectations influenced the interaction.
Individualism vs. Collectivism in Crew Dynamics
Individualistic cultures emphasize personal accountability and independent decision-making, while collectivist cultures prioritize group harmony and consensus. In an individualistic cockpit, a pilot may feel comfortable stating a personal opinion even if it contradicts the group. In a collectivist cockpit, the same pilot might prioritize agreement and avoid direct confrontation, potentially leading to groupthink or incomplete briefings. Simulation exercises can deliberately create tensions between individual and group priorities—for example, during a time-critical diversion decision where crew members must balance personal judgment with team consensus. Practicing these scenarios builds awareness of how cultural orientation shapes behavior and helps crews develop strategies that respect both individual expertise and team cohesion.
Designing Culturally Competent Flight Simulation Scenarios
Creating Realistic Multicultural Environments
The most effective simulation scenarios reflect the actual diversity of the operational environment. Trainers should incorporate characters with distinct cultural backgrounds, accents, communication styles, and authority expectations. This can be achieved through voice actors, pre-recorded communications, or role-playing by instructors and trainees. For example, a scenario might include an air traffic controller from a high-context culture who uses indirect phraseology, or a ground crew member from a culture where greetings and rapport-building precede task communication. The realism extends beyond dialogue: visual cues such as signage, cockpit documentation in different languages, and simulated cultural norms around personal space and eye contact further immerse trainees in a multicultural context.
Role-Playing with Diverse Characters
Role-playing allows participants to step into perspectives different from their own, fostering empathy and adaptability. In a simulation, a pilot might take on the role of a flight engineer from a culture with a different approach to hierarchy, or a cabin crew member interacting with passengers from various cultural backgrounds. Debriefing sessions should explicitly address the cultural dynamics observed, asking questions such as: "How did your cultural background influence your communication choice in that moment?" and "What would you do differently if you recognized a high-context cue you initially missed?" This reflective practice cements learning and builds the mental flexibility required in real-world operations.
Scenario Examples for Cultural Competency Training
- Authority and Assertiveness: A junior first officer notices the captain has selected the wrong runway data during approach. The officer comes from a high power distance culture. The scenario requires them to speak up in a way that respects authority while fulfilling safety obligations.
- Indirect Communication in Emergencies: During an engine failure drill, the co-pilot, from a high-context culture, expresses concern indirectly. The captain must recognize the cue and push for explicit confirmation of the issue before proceeding.
- Multicultural Crew Briefing: A pre-flight briefing involves crew members from both individualistic and collectivist backgrounds. The scenario tests whether the team establishes a communication norm that encourages open input from all members.
- Cross-Cultural Passenger Interaction: Cabin crew must manage a passenger who is distressed due to cultural norms around gender, physical contact, or religious practices during an emergency drill.
Enhancing Communication Skills Through Simulation
Communication skills in aviation extend beyond vocabulary and pronunciation. They encompass the ability to transmit information clearly, listen actively, verify understanding, and adapt to changing conditions. Flight simulators provide a high-fidelity platform to stress-test these abilities under realistic operational pressure.
Standardized Phraseology and Its Limitations
Standardized phraseology—such as that defined by ICAO—reduces ambiguity by prescribing specific terms, structures, and responses for common aviation communications. However, no phraseology covers every situation, especially during non-normal events or interactions with non-native English speakers. Simulation scenarios can expose trainees to situations where standard phraseology is insufficient, forcing them to use plain language while maintaining clarity and brevity. For example, a scenario might involve an ATC controller with limited English proficiency who misinterprets a standard instruction; the pilot must detect the misunderstanding and rephrase without introducing new ambiguity. This practice builds the skill of code-switching between standardized and plain language as the situation demands.
Active Listening and Closed-Loop Communication
Closed-loop communication—where the receiver repeats back the message and the sender confirms accuracy—is a cornerstone of aviation safety. Yet in high-stress or cross-cultural contexts, crew members may skip steps or assume understanding. Simulation sessions should include scenarios that deliberately create conditions for communication breakdown: high ambient noise, time pressure, overlapping transmissions, or participants from cultures where repeating back can feel disrespectful. Training participants to persist with closed-loop techniques while remaining culturally sensitive requires deliberate practice. FAA human factors guidance emphasizes the importance of these techniques in both flight deck and maintenance operations, making them essential for any simulation curriculum.
Assertiveness and Crew Resource Management
Assertiveness—the ability to express a concern or opinion clearly without aggression—remains a challenge in culturally diverse cockpits. Some cultures value direct assertiveness as a sign of competence, while others view it as disrespectful to seniority. Simulation scenarios can train individuals to calibrate their assertiveness level based on the cultural context of the team. For instance, a scenario might require a pilot to challenge an incorrect decision using graded assertiveness: starting with a subtle question, escalating to a direct statement, and finally taking control if safety demands it. Practicing this gradient helps trainees find a communication style that is both effective and culturally appropriate.
Stress Testing Communication Under Workload
Communication skills degrade under stress, fatigue, and high workload—the exact conditions where they matter most. Simulators can introduce simultaneous demands: abnormal checklists, time-critical decisions, ATC communication in a non-native language, and cabin crew requests. Trainees must prioritize, delegate, and maintain clear loops despite the pressure. Adding cultural variables—such as a crew member who becomes quieter under stress (a common pattern in some cultures) or one who becomes more verbal—prepares participants for the full range of human responses they will encounter. Practical Strategies for Implementation in Training Programs
Integrating cultural competency and communication skills into existing simulation programs does not require a complete overhaul. Training managers and instructors can adopt incremental strategies that layer cultural awareness onto current scenarios without sacrificing technical proficiency.
- Start with a cultural self-assessment. Before running simulations, have trainees complete a simple cultural values survey (such as Hofstede's dimensions) to increase self-awareness. Debriefing can then connect personal cultural orientation to observed behaviors in the sim.
- Embed one cultural variable per scenario. Rather than overwhelming trainees with multiple cultural dimensions at once, introduce one variable per session. For example, one session focuses on power distance, another on communication context. This allows gradual skill building.
- Use video-based pre-briefs. Show trainees short clips of cross-cultural interactions before the sim session, highlighting communication breakdowns. Ask them to identify what went wrong and how to avoid it. This primes them for the scenario.
- Debrief with a cultural lens. Standard debriefing questions should include at least one cultural or communication-focused question. For example: "Was there a moment where cultural differences affected how information was shared?" or "How did your communication style change under pressure?"
- Rotate roles and cultural perspectives. Have trainees play different cultural roles across multiple sessions. This builds empathy and flexibility, reducing the tendency to default to one communication mode.
- Track communication errors over time. Maintain a simple log of communication breakdowns observed during simulation sessions. Use this data to identify recurring patterns and adjust training focus accordingly.
Measuring the Impact of Cultural Competency and Communication Training
To justify investment in these training enhancements, organizations must measure their effectiveness. Traditional metrics such as pass/fail rates on technical maneuvers capture only part of the picture. A more comprehensive evaluation framework includes both quantitative and qualitative measures specific to communication and cultural competency.
Behavioral Observation and Rubrics
Instructors can use behaviorally anchored rating scales (BARS) to assess communication and cultural skills during simulation. Example criteria include: uses closed-loop communication consistently; adapts communication style to cultural cues; speaks up assertively when safety is at risk; verifies understanding with team members. Ratings during the scenario provide immediate feedback and track improvement across multiple sessions. Trainee Self-Reflection and Surveys
Pre- and post-training surveys can measure shifts in cultural awareness, confidence in cross-cultural communication, and attitudes toward CRM principles. Open-ended questions such as "Describe a situation where cultural differences affected your communication" provide rich qualitative data. Comparing responses over time reveals whether training is translating into real-world awareness and behavior change.
Operational Performance Indicators
Ultimately, the value of simulation training appears in operational performance. Organizations can track indicators such as the frequency of communication-related incidents, crew feedback on team dynamics, and performance in line checks and assessments. While isolating the impact of simulation alone is difficult, a consistent trend toward improved communication metrics across the training population strongly suggests effectiveness.
Challenges and Solutions in Implementation
Introducing cultural competency training into flight simulation is not without obstacles. Trainers may lack confidence in facilitating cross-cultural discussions, trainees may feel uncomfortable with role-playing that touches on identity, and organizations may question the return on investment. Addressing these challenges directly prevents resistance and ensures sustainable integration.
- Instructor training: Provide instructors with facilitation guides and cultural awareness training before they lead simulation sessions. Instructors do not need to be cultural experts, but they must be able to create a respectful environment for discussion and guide debriefing without judgment.
- Creating psychological safety: Emphasize that cultural competency training is about building skills, not assigning blame. Set ground rules: no personal criticism, confidentiality about trainee backgrounds, and a focus on observable behaviors rather than stereotypes.
- Gradual integration: Start with pilot programs in one training center or fleet, collect feedback, and refine before wider rollout. This reduces risk and builds internal advocates who can demonstrate value to skeptics.
- Tie to existing mandates: Align cultural competency objectives with existing CRM, language proficiency, and safety management system requirements. This frames the training as an enhancement to compliance rather than an additional burden.
